A leaked firmware string suggests the Galaxy S26 Ultra will finally get a rumored upgrade to faster 60W wired charging.
A new firmware leak suggests the Galaxy S26 Ultra will support 60W wired charging.
That’s a major jump from the 45W limit on previous Ultra models, though still slower than some rivals.
The phone is expected to keep its 5,000mAh battery and use the Snapdragon 8 Elite 2 chipset.
Samsung might not be boosting battery capacity on its next high-end flagship, but it looks like faster charging is finally on the cards for the Galaxy S26 Ultra.
Tipter Erencan Yılmaz on X (via SamMobile) spotted a reference to the device’s charging speed in a new One UI 8.
